Description

One is cut down trees device fast
Technical field
The utility model relates to forestry production technique apparatus field, more specifically relates to one and cuts down trees fast device.
Background technology
The huge job during exploitation of forestry, especially for the season of little sapling in nursery, it is necessary to carrying out a large amount of exploitations, due to the restriction of envrionment conditions, huge machinery does not enter the woods. Current people are undertaken digging getting by spade, then undertaken pulling out tree by manual work, labour intensity is big, operation speed is slow, often the problem that the delay of duration second is incured loss through delay occur moving, existing equipment carries very not to be put just, and the bigger comparison of build is heavy, add the burden of staff in the wild, therefore it is badly in need of a kind of small-sized device of cutting down trees fast.

Embodiment
Embodiment one:
Below in conjunction with Fig. 1, 2 explanation present embodiments, the utility model relates to forestry production technique apparatus field, more specifically one is cut down trees device fast, comprise: base expansion link 1, tightening screw 2, base telescopic shaft 3, mount pad 4, dig cutter 5, retaining plate 6, universal take turns 7, vibration motor 8, store battery 9, support sleeve 10, stiffening web 11, support telescopic bar 12, cross bar 13, pulley I14, pulley II15, hydro-cylinder 16, governor lever 17, wireline retaining clip 18, wireline 19, connecting screw rod group 20, rope-winding wheel permanent seat 21, rope-winding wheel 22 and motor 23, dig cutter by the vibration of vibration motor, by completing, digging of trees is taken as industry, then the operation of choosing to trees is completed by the dual function of hydro-cylinder and motor, dig that to get trees speed fast, reduce labour intensity.
Connecting screw rod group 20 comprises connecting screw rod 20-1 and nut 20-2, and the end of connecting screw rod 20-1 is provided with wireline perforation 20-1-1.
Base expansion link 1 is inserted in base telescopic shaft 3, and tightening screw 2 is by fixing between base expansion link 1 and base telescopic shaft 3; The degree of depth being inserted in base telescopic shaft 3 by adjustment base expansion link 1 so that stable being placed on around trees of device of cutting down trees fast. Mount pad 4 is fixedly connected on the inwall of base telescopic shaft 3, digging cutter 5 is inserted in mount pad 4, dig cutter 5 to be fixed by tightening screw 2 with mount pad 4, the relative position between cutter 5 and mount pad 4 is dug by adjustment, make to dig the degree of depth that cutter 5 extend in soil adjusted, the degree of depth of cutter 5 is dug in situation adjustment according to trees, facilitates digging of trees to get. Retaining plate 6 is fixedly connected on the rear end of base telescopic shaft 3, universal takes turns the bottom that 7 are fixedly connected on retaining plate 6; Universal take turns 7 for the movement of device of cutting down trees fast and provide convenience. The lower end supporting sleeve 10 is fixedly connected on base telescopic shaft 3, the lower end of support telescopic bar 12 is sleeved on the inside supporting sleeve 10, stiffening web 11 is connected to and supports on sleeve 10 and base telescopic shaft 3, supports and is fixed by tightening screw between sleeve 10 and support telescopic bar 12; The upper end of support telescopic bar 12 and the rear end of cross bar 13 are articulated and connected, and pulley I14 is arranged on the front end of cross bar 13, and pulley II15 is arranged on the rear end of cross bar 13; Upper end and the cross bar 13 of hydro-cylinder 16 are articulated and connected, lower end and the support telescopic bar 12 of hydro-cylinder 16 are articulated and connected, governor lever 17 is arranged on hydro-cylinder 16, the inside of the wireline retaining clip 18 that connecting screw rod 20-1 is arranged on, wireline 19 is arranged on connecting screw rod 20-1 through wireline perforation 20-1-1, the nut 20-2 on wireline retaining clip 18 and connecting screw rod 20-1; And pulley I14 walked around from front to back successively by wireline 19 and its end of pulley II15 is wrapped on rope-winding wheel 22, rope-winding wheel 22 is arranged on rope-winding wheel permanent seat 21, rope-winding wheel permanent seat 21 is connected on support telescopic bar 12, motor 23 is arranged on rope-winding wheel permanent seat 21, and the output shaft of motor 23 is connected with the rotating shaft of rope-winding wheel 22. Vibrate motor 8 and all it is connected by electric wire between motor 23 with store battery 9.
Being placed on around trees by device of cutting down trees fast, after adjusting adjustment base expansion link 1 being inserted into base telescopic shaft 3 degree of depth, tied up to by trunk in the ring of wireline 19, trunk is fixed by fastening nut 20-2. Open vibration motor 8, under the vibration of vibration motor 8, dig cutter 5 will be deep into underground, by completing, digging of trees is taken as industry, then by lifting hydraulic cylinder 16, hydro-cylinder 16 is by cross bar 13 jack-up, and opening motor 26 drives rope-winding wheel 22 to rotate being wrapped on rope-winding wheel 22 of making wireline 19 further, thus completes choosing of trees, is hung out from Shu Keng by trees. Complete the operation of choosing to trees in the dual function of hydro-cylinder 16 and unlatching motor 26, dig and get trees speed soon, reduce labour intensity.
